What Should You Consider When Choosing the Best Cordless Rechargeable Vacuum?
When choosing the best cordless rechargeable vacuum, several important factors should be taken into account:
- Battery Life: A crucial feature, battery life determines how long the vacuum can operate before needing a recharge. Look for models that provide at least 30-40 minutes of run time, especially if you have a larger area to clean.
- Suction Power: The effectiveness of a vacuum largely depends on its suction power. Check for specifications that indicate the vacuum’s air wattage or suction strength, as higher values generally indicate better performance in picking up dirt and debris.
- Weight and Maneuverability: The weight of the vacuum affects how easy it is to carry and use, especially for extended cleaning sessions. Opt for a lightweight model that is easy to maneuver around furniture and can be used comfortably for various cleaning tasks.
- Dustbin Capacity: A larger dustbin means less frequent emptying, which can enhance the cleaning experience. Consider how much dirt and debris the vacuum can hold and whether it has an easy-to-empty design.
- Attachments and Features: Additional tools like crevice tools, brushes, or motorized heads can enhance versatility. Evaluate whether the vacuum comes with useful attachments that cater to specific cleaning needs, such as pet hair removal or upholstery cleaning.
- Filtration System: A good filtration system is essential, especially for allergy sufferers. Look for vacuums equipped with HEPA filters that can trap fine particles and allergens effectively.
- Charging Time: The duration it takes to recharge the battery can significantly impact convenience. Choose a vacuum with a shorter charging time, ideally under four hours, to minimize downtime between uses.
- Price and Warranty: Budget is always a consideration, so it’s important to find a vacuum that offers good value for money. Additionally, a solid warranty can provide peace of mind regarding the vacuum’s durability and performance.

How Do I Maintain My Cordless Rechargeable Vacuum for Optimal Performance?
To maintain your cordless rechargeable vacuum for optimal performance, consider the following essential practices:
- Regularly Clean the Filters: Keeping the filters clean is crucial for maintaining suction power. Most cordless vacuums come with washable filters that should be rinsed under water and allowed to dry completely before reinserting.
- Empty the Dustbin Frequently: A full dustbin can hinder performance, so it’s important to empty it after each use. Ensure you tap out any clogs or debris stuck in the dustbin to help maintain the vacuum’s efficiency.
- Charge the Battery Properly: To prolong battery life, avoid letting it fully discharge before recharging. Instead, charge your vacuum after each use to keep it ready for the next cleaning session.
- Inspect and Clean the Brush Roll: Hair and debris can accumulate on the brush roll, reducing its effectiveness. Regularly check for blockages and remove any tangled hair to ensure optimal performance.
- Store in a Cool, Dry Place: Storing your vacuum in extreme temperatures can affect battery performance. Keep it in a climate-controlled environment to help maintain battery health and the overall longevity of the unit.
- Check for Software Updates: Some modern cordless vacuums come with smart features that may require software updates. Regularly check the manufacturer’s website or app to ensure your vacuum is running the latest firmware.
- Inspect the Charging Dock: Ensure the charging dock is clean and that the connections are clear of dust or debris. A dirty charging dock can lead to slow charging times or battery issues.
